The Department of Translational Medicine and Physiology welcomes Shawn Xu, PhD, Bernard W. Agranoff Collegiate Professor of the Life Sciences Institute, University of Michigan – Ann Arbor to WSU Spokane on Tuesday, September 20, 2022.

He will be providing his seminar at noon titled, “How Do We Sense the World? Lessons from the Worm”, in SAC 20 or via Zoom.

Xu joined the University of Michigan in 2005 with a faculty appointment in the Department of Molecular & Integrative Physiology and in the Life Sciences Institute. Currently, Xu is Bernard W. Agranoff Collegiate Professor of the Life Sciences in the Life Sciences Institute. He is also a Professor of Molecular & Integrative Physiology at U-M Medical School. Prior to joining U-M, Xu completed his post-doctoral training at the California Institute of Technology.

Xu has received the Pew Scholar award, Sloan fellow, Helen Hay Whitney Foundation Postdoctoral Fellowship and Harold M. Weintraub Graduate Student Award.
